How much do divisional general man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for divisional general manager in Colbert, GA is $98,096.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$67,400.00 and $119,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a divisional general manager?

Divisional General Managers are senior executives responsible for overseeing the operations, performance, and strategy of a specific division within a larger organization. They manage budgets, set goals, coordinate resources, and ensure that their division meets corporate objectives. Divisional General Managers act as a bridge between upper management and division staff, reporting on progress and implementing corporate policies at the divisional level. Their role is critical in driving growth, profitability, and operational efficiency within their assigned business unit.

How does a divisional general manager balance strategic planning with day-to-day operational oversight?

Divisional General Managers (DGMs) are responsible for both setting long-term strategic direction and ensuring smooth daily operations within their division. This often involves delegating routine management tasks to department heads, while maintaining regular communication to stay informed about operational challenges. DGMs usually set clear performance goals, monitor key metrics, and adjust strategies as needed. Balancing these responsibilities requires strong leadership, effective time management, and the ability to prioritize high-impact activities while fostering collaboration across te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a divisional general manager?

To thrive as a Divisional General Manager, you need strong leadership, business acumen, strategic planning abilities, and a relevant bachelor's or master's degree in business or management. Familiarity with ERP systems, financial analysis tools, and performance management software is typically required. Exceptional communication, decision-making, and team-building skills help a manager motivate teams and drive organizational goals. These skills ensure effective oversight of division operations, achievement of financial targets, and alignment with overall company strategy.

What is the difference between Divisional General Manager vs Regional Manager?

AspectDivisional General ManagerRegional Manager
ResponsibilitiesOversees multiple departments within a division, sets strategic goals, manages divisional performanceManages operations within a specific geographic region, focuses on regional sales, customer relations, and team management
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ree, often an MBA, with extensive management experienceRequires a bachelor's degree, experience in sales or operations, and regional management skills
Work EnvironmentCorporate office, strategic planning sessions, cross-department coordinationRegional offices, client sites, local team management

The Divisional General Manager oversees multiple departments within a division, focusing on strategic and operational leadership across a broad scope. In contrast, the Regional Manager concentrates on managing operations within a specific geographic area, emphasizing regional sales and customer engagement. Both roles require strong leadership and management skills, but the Divisional General Manager typically has a broader strategic focus and higher level of responsibility within the organization.

Job description

At RaceTrac, our Co-Managers are the heartbeat of the store - supporting the General Manager, leading by example, and helping teams deliver exceptional guest experiences every day. If you're a driven leader ready to grow your career, take ownership of your results, and develop a winning team, this is your next step. As a Co-Manager, you'll play a key role in driving the store’s performance, developing top-tier talent, and bringing RaceTrac’s mission to life: making people’s lives simpler and more enjoyable.

What’s In It for You?

  • Competitive pay and performance-based incentives
  • Promotion potential – many of our General Managers were Co-Managers first!
  • Leadership training and development that prepares you for what’s next
  • Operate with autonomy while supported by proven systems and tools
  • A dynamic, high-volume environment where leadership is hands-on and meaningful
  • Full benefits package – including medical, dental, vision, 401(K), PTO, and more!

What You’ll Do

Lead & Develop a High-Performing Team

  • Cultivate a guest-first culture, ensuring every interaction is welcoming and efficient
  • Mentor and support Shift Managers and team members through training and coaching
  • Empower teams by setting clear expectations, providing feedback, and leading by example
  • Foster open communication and collaboration across all shifts

Support Operational Excellence

  • Assist in executing store-level strategies to drive sales, guest satisfaction, and profitability
  • Monitor and manage inventory levels, vendor relationships, and cash control
  • Drive promotional execution, ensure food service compliance, and elevate the in-store experience
  • Ensure the store is clean, stocked, and aligned with RaceTrac brand standards

Champion Food Safety & Compliance

  • Conduct regular food quality checks and coach the team on food safety standards
  • Ensure compliance with safety regulations and company policies
  • Maintain and organize required documentation for audits or inspections

Drive Results Through Collaboration

  • Analyze reports, identify trends, and take action to improve store performance
  • Support team scheduling and staffing needs in coordination with the General Manager
  • Provide performance feedback and help drive accountability across the team

What We’re Looking For

  • 3-5 years of experience in retail, food service, or restaurant leadership
  • 1+ year of management experience preferred
  • Strong coaching, communication, and problem-solving skills
  • Experience in high-volume, guest-focused environments
  • Ability to read and act on business metrics such as P&L, labor, and sales

Must Haves for This Role

  • High School Diploma or GED, in progress or completed
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s. and perform physical tasks as needed
  • Willing to obtain and maintain food handler and alcohol server permits (if required)
